Will the noble Baroness please accept that that is simply not so? I have made it abundantly clear that a regional assembly cannot be set up until after the next general election. The time required for the boundary review, for the referendum and for progress on the main Bill mean that there is no prospect whatever of a regional assembly being up and running this side of the next general election.
